The first quarter of the 21st century has produced an extraordinary array of cinematic masterpieces, and critics have worked to establish a new canon. The BBC's 2016 list, compiled from 177 critics worldwide, placed (David Lynch, 2001) at its peak, followed closely by "In the Mood for Love" (Wong Kar-wai, 2000) and "There Will Be Blood" (Paul Thomas Anderson, 2007). This list highlighted the global nature of modern cinema, including works like "Spirited Away" (Hayao Miyazaki, 2001) and "Boyhood" (Richard Linklater, 2014) as essential viewing.
